Cash rewards is what the card has been. A couple of weeks ago, they added the signature card. So, now they offer 2 sig cards. Flagship and cash rewards. The cash rewards sig has no AF, at least at this time. Many people with $5k+ CLs were automatically upgraded to the sig card.
Signature benefits are in addition to the cash rewards. SigCCs start at $5k CL.
Navy's sig card will report CLs on the CRAs. Not all sig visas or world master cards report CLs to the CRAs.
